Is the round decided in advance? Check it yourself
Before every round the demo draws a secret seed and shows you its SHA-256 hash. The flight point is worked out from the seed itself, so it is fixed before your bet — while the hash on its own gives nothing away, because a SHA-256 hash cannot be turned back into the seed it came from.

When the round ends the seed is revealed. Paste it into any SHA-256 tool: you get back the hash that was shown before take-off, which proves the round was settled in advance and not changed while you played. Real crash games publish the same kind of proof.

Aviator explained
- Aviator is a crash-style game where a multiplier rises until it stops at a random point.
- You choose when to cash out; if you wait past the stop, the round is lost.
- Published RTP for Aviator is about 97%, leaving roughly a 3% house edge.
- Online casino play is restricted for Australian residents under the Interactive Gambling Act 2001.

A free demo round — a simulation, not real-money play
The block above is a browser simulation that runs on practice credits. Nothing is deposited, nothing is paid out and no account is involved: you place a practice stake, the multiplier climbs and you cash out before the plane leaves. It is here to explain the mechanic, which is hard to picture from a written description alone.
It also makes the house edge visible. The demo runs at the published 97% RTP, so over a long run of rounds the practice balance drifts down by roughly 3% of everything staked, whatever cash-out target you pick. That is the maths of the game, not a bad streak. Online casino play is restricted for Australian residents under the Interactive Gambling Act 2001, and this page is informational only. 18+.
